Associated space launch

Military communications satellites

COSMOS 1566 was lifted into orbit during the mission ‘Kosmos-3M | Strela-1M 281-288’, on board a Kosmos-3M space rocket.

The launch took place on May 28, 1984, 9:52 p.m. from 132/2.
